Restorative Aide
St. Luke's Hospital
PURPOSE: The Restorative Aide provides maintenance type therapy programs as designated by the Physical Therapist, including range of motion and mobility for the residents of St. Luke Living Center in order to promote comfort and maintain their functional ability contributing to their overall resident care program. LOCATION: The Restorative Aide reports directly to the Living Center Director. ENVIRONMENT: St. Luke Living Center is a nursing facility licensed for 32 beds. The Living Center is a working environment that has a busy atmosphere with frequent interruptions. The work requires the ability to do heavy lifting exerting up to 50 to 75 lbs. of force, walking, standing, sitting, reaching, stooping, squatting and kneeling. A multidisciplinary approach is used in the Living Center which includes an individualized care plan which is the deriving force for addressing the residents' physical, social and psychosocial needs. CHALLENGE: The major challenge for this position is to ensure that restorative treatments are administered as outlined by the consulting Physical Therapist or Physician and that treatments are modified when necessary to provide maximum benefit and safety for the Resident. FUNCTIONS: The Restorative Aide performs or assists residents with range of motion, mobility, ambulation and other rehabilitation exercises according to the resident's personal needs and as directed by the physical therapist and/or physician. The RA maintains daily records, noting response and progress to the restorative program. This person will assure resident safety, always using a gait belt when ambulating or transferring residents or ask for assistance by other staff when needed. Concerns and observations regarding the residents restorative needs are reported to the physical therapist and/or to the Resident Care Plan Team for discussion and followup. The RA is a contributing member of the Care Plan Team being responsible for documenting problems, goals, approaches and evaluations for each resident. The RA will assist as needed in performing general nursing care duties such as answering call lights, assisting CNA's as needed with activities of daily living, passing and collecting food trays, providing assistance with feeding residents and taking the snack cart around to residents. This position respects the resident's freedom of choice and integrates the Choices Philosophy into daily routine. LATITUDE: The Restorative Aide confers with the consulting physical therapist to exchange, discuss and evaluate the individuals treatment plan. The RA is expected to prioritize daily assignments and activities and seeks direction and guidance from the charge nurse, Living Center Director and/or Resident Care Plan Team when problems and concerns occur. CONTACTS: The RA is in frequent contact with residents in performing restorative duties. This position is also in contact with other resident care staff to gather and relay pertinent information. There is contact with family, visitors and friends of residents and other staff of the hospital and Living Center. KNOWLEDGE AND EXPERIENCE: The position of Restorative Aide here at St. Luke requires a current certification as a Nursing Assistant in the State of Kansas and it is recommended that the Restorative Aide Course be completed. It is preferred that the person have 2 years of experience working with the elderly.
